Transaction

855b837a66ac4a400992a0ed15cd76f1fd697d048be27884d1344f4a0e82f2be

Summary

In Block689929
TimeThu, 09 May 2024 11:15:45 UTC
Total Input610.33541667 Nebula
Total Output644.33541667 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
276400 Confirmations644.33541667 Nebula
Raw Transaction